📜  什么是ID(1)

📅  最后修改于: 2023-12-03 15:36:09.083000             🧑  作者: Mango

什么是ID

简介

ID(Identifier)是指在编程语言中用来标识某个特定对象的名称或标识符。在HTML、CSS、JavaScript等Web开发语言中,ID通常用来标识网页中的某个特定元素,例如某个按钮、输入框、图片等。

ID的作用

1.提供唯一标识符:ID为每个元素提供了唯一的标识符,方便网页开发人员在JavaScript、CSS等代码中选取特定的元素进行操作。

2.实现网页内部跳转:通过ID,网页开发人员可以实现内部跳转,让用户直接跳转到网页中的某个特定元素。

3.优化搜索引擎:搜索引擎会根据网页中的ID来确定网页的内容,因此在网页中添加ID可以提高搜索引擎的索引效果。

ID的命名规则

HTML中ID的命名规则比较灵活,但一般需要遵循以下规则:

1.ID名称必须唯一:在同一网页中,每个元素的ID名称必须唯一,不能重复。

2.由字母、数字、下划线组成:ID名称只能由字母、数字和下划线组成,不能包含空格或其他特殊字符。

3.以字母或下划线开头:ID名称必须以字母或下划线开头,不能以数字开头。

如何定义ID

在HTML中,使用id属性来为元素定义ID,语法如下:

<element id="name"></element>

示例代码:

<button id="btn-submit">提交</button>

在CSS中,可以使用#符号来选取ID所对应的元素,语法如下:

#name { property:value; }

示例代码:

#btn-submit { background-color: blue; }

在JavaScript中,可以使用getElementById()方法来获取指定ID所对应的元素,语法如下:

document.getElementById("name");

示例代码:

document.getElementById("btn-submit").addEventListener('click', function(){
    // do something
});
总结

ID是Web开发中重要的元素标识符,可以提供唯一标识符、实现内部跳转以及优化搜索引擎等功能。需要注意ID的命名规则,以及如何在HTML、CSS、JavaScript中定义ID。